Transaction 81cabf4e3543f8dceda15498ac2bec6e588bbfd8b63d8c242b9195633ce0d305
1 Input
1 Output
-
81cabf4e3543f8dceda15498ac2bec6e588bbfd8b63d8c242b9195633ce0d305:0
- value
- 252358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80f57a663336bbd79f9919cb88690ef54360d105 OP_EQUAL
- address
- 3DStVDY9xxhyqqLrAb1XzMPDb1KtNhXBjr